Berkeley: University of California Press, 1972. First Thus. Cloth. Near Fine/Very Good. 8vo. Frontis., x, 740 pp. Edited and with an Introduction by John S. Tuckey. Text established by Kenneth M. Sanderson and Bernard L. Stein. This is one in the series of unpublished Mark Twin Papers edited by Frederick Anderson. Some mild soiling to edges. Dustjacket shows wear typical of matte paper, a couple of creases and closed tears, darkening to spine and rubbing.
